OSCARS WATCH 2025 – Anora

This post is part of a series of critical responses to the films nominated for Best Picture at the 97th Academy Awards.

With this video essay, Green and Red perform a poetic analysis of both the style and content of Best Picture nominee Anora, evoking Kogonada's use of the dotted line and the driving poetic force of Catherine Grant's "Carnal Locomotive."

The following video contains some nudity and references mature content.

For creating a world for a face. For pushing the idea of creating a film for an actor to its limits. For seizing control of the world amidst the uncontrollable guerilla filmmaking. For seeing light in the darkest places, rising from the east. In Farsi, Pomegranate is Anaar انار)), Light is Noor نور)), and this is Anora (آنورا).
